HTML基础知识:段落与标记语言详解

需积分: 26 1 下载量 115 浏览量 更新于2024-08-17 收藏 937KB PPT 举报
"本文主要介绍了HTML中的段落标记、换行标记以及不换行标记的使用方法,并提及了HTML在网页制作中的基本构成元素和技术构成。同时,文章概述了HTML的发展历史、设计原则以及HTML文件的基本结构。" 在HTML中,段落标记`<p>`用于创建一个新的段落,它相当于在文本中按下Enter键产生的效果。当你在网页内容中插入`<p>`标签时,浏览器会在该标签前后自动添加一些空白,以区分不同的段落。例如: ```html <p>这是一个段落。</p> <p>这是另一个段落。</p> ``` 换行标记`<br>`则用于进行线性换行,它相当于在文本编辑器中使用Shift + Enter所产生的软回车。这个标签不会像`<p>`那样产生新的段落间距,只是简单地将文本换到下一行。如: ```html 这是一行文本。<br>这是在同一段内的下一行。 ``` `<nobr>`标记用于阻止文本自动换行,确保所有内容都在同一行内显示,直到遇到`</nobr>`结束标签。这在需要强制文本不换行显示时非常有用,比如在窄列布局中: ```html <nobr>这段文本不会自动换行,即使超出容器宽度也依然在同一行。</nobr> ``` 此外,段落`<p>`还可以通过设置对齐属性`align`来改变其在页面上的位置。基本语法为`<p align="left|right|center">`,其中`left`表示左对齐,`right`表示右对齐,`center`表示居中对齐。例如: ```html <p align="center">这是居中对齐的段落。</p> <p align="right">这是右对齐的段落。</p> ``` 网页制作的基础元素包括文本、图像、超链接、表格、表单、动画和框架。HTML(超文本标记语言)是网页的基本构成部分,它定义了网页的结构;CSS(层叠样式表)负责样式和布局;JavaScript等脚本语言则提供了交互性和动态功能。此外,还有如CGI、PHP、JSP、ASP、CFML、XML、ASP.NET等不同类型的服务器端技术和语言,用于实现更复杂的网页交互和数据处理。 HTML的发展经历了多个阶段,设计原则强调统一化、国际化和易用性。HTML5引入了更多新特性,如表格、合成文档、样式表、脚本语言支持、打印优化和更好的易用性设计。编写HTML文件可以通过直接手写代码、使用可视化编辑器或让服务器动态生成等方式完成,而HTML文件的基本结构通常包括`<html>`、`<head>`、`<body>`等标签。 在编写HTML文件时,需要注意以下几点: 1. 标记通常由尖括号`<`和`>`包围,如`<p>`和`</p>`。 2. 标记可以嵌套,如`<h1><center>...</center></h1>`。 3. HTML代码不区分大小写,`<CENTER>`和`<center>`效果相同。 4. 回车和空格在源代码中不影响显示,但可以通过CSS控制。 5. 标记可以带有属性,如`<b>`(加粗)可以写作`<b style="color:red;">`来同时改变颜色。